# Anticipated Updates in Apple’s Product Range: What to Anticipate in October

Apple is preparing for its upcoming keynote presentation, slated for October, where new iPad and Mac products are expected to take center stage. Typically, the launch of new models coincides with the discontinuation of older versions. Here’s an overview of the Apple products that may soon be off the shelves after the event.

## M3 MacBook Pros

Among the most eagerly awaited announcements is the introduction of the new 14-inch and 16-inch MacBook Pros, predicted to showcase the latest M4, M4 Pro, and M4 Max processors. Although the MacBook Pro’s design is anticipated to remain mostly the same, the entry-level model will likely come with 16GB of RAM, a notable enhancement from earlier versions. Furthermore, there are speculations that the entry-level model could launch in a new shade, Space Black, taking the place of the usual Space Gray.

## M2 Mac mini

The Mac mini is poised for its most significant redesign in 14 years, featuring a smaller form factor and repositioned ports at the front for more convenient access. The last iteration of the Mac mini was in January 2023, introducing M2 and M2 Pro chips. With the forthcoming redesign, we expect the arrival of M4 and M4 Pro chips, signaling a considerable boost in performance for this adaptable desktop.

## M3 iMac

A refresh of the iMac is also on the horizon, moving from the M3 chip to the M4 chip. This advancement is projected to be quite incremental, but it might involve changes in accessories, with the Magic Keyboard, Magic Mouse, and Magic Trackpad transitioning from Lightning to USB-C connectivity. This update aligns with Apple’s wider initiative to unify its accessory connections across its products.

## iPad mini 6

After a three-year gap, the iPad mini is finally set for an update. The upcoming model is expected to incorporate a more powerful chip, likely the A18, in addition to compatibility with the Apple Pencil Pro. Moreover, enhancements to the display are likely to resolve the jelly scrolling phenomenon, and the base model may now feature 128GB of storage, boosting its attractiveness for users in search of a compact yet capable tablet.

## iPad 10?

There are conflicting indications regarding the potential launch of a new entry-level iPad. Reports suggest that display panels for the base model iPad are scheduled to ship shortly, hinting at a spring rollout. However, Bloomberg’s Mark Gurman proposes that fresh lower-end iPads could emerge in October, raising the prospect of a refresh for both the base model iPad and the iPad mini. If Gurman’s predictions are accurate, the existing iPad 10 might be replaced by the soon-to-be-released 11th generation iPad.
